College Journey launched in 2024 and has put out 109 episodes in the time since. That works out to roughly 30 hours of audio in total. Releases follow a near-daily cadence.

Episodes typically run ten to twenty minutes — most land between 12 min and 18 min — though episode length varies meaningfully from one episode to the next. None of the episodes are flagged explicit by the publisher. It is catalogued as a EN-language Education show.

The catalogue appears to be on hiatus or wound down — the most recent episode landed 1.3 years ago, with no new episodes in over a year. Published by Josh Roman.

Ep 94What Are the 5 C’s of College Choice?

This article introduces the "5 C's" of college choice: Curriculum, Campus, Community, Career, and Cost. It breaks down each factor to help students prioritize and simplify the decision-making process.
